#b57632 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b57632 is composed of 71% red, 46.3%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.8% magenta, 72.4%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 31.1 degrees, a saturation of 56.7% and a lightness of 45.3%. #b57632 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ffec64 with #6b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#b57632 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b57632 has RGB values of R:181, G:118,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.35, Y:0.72,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11892274.

Shades and Tints of #b57632
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0803 is the darkest color, while #fefdfc is the lightest one.
